Perfluoroelastomer (FFKM)
Composition:
This perfluoroelastomer (FFKM) is made of Terpolymer of tetrafluoroethylene, perfluoro methyl vinyl ether and perfluoro phenoxy propyl vinyl ether.
Features and Applications:
This perfluoroelastomer (FFKM) parts has the feature of chemical resistance and thermal stability, so compared with other elastomers, they has longer usage life and can seal more effectively.
Thanks to the excessive swelling, FFKM parts can withstand attack by over 1,800 chemicals, such as many acids and amines that cause other elastomers to fail to work. Being long-term to high-temperature up to 280, FFKM still has the feature of elasticity and recovery properties which is better than other high-temperature elastomers.
Perfluoroelastomer or FFKM parts have more advanced properties, such as seal integrity, maintenance reducing and operating costs. Moreover, we provide reliable and long-term service. It is widely used in chemical processing, semiconductor wafer processing, pharmaceutical, oil and gas recovery, aerospace and petroleum applications.
